Great info for a beginner or someone who just wants programs
Given Nick Tuminello's extensive online presence and history of referencing science, I had hoped for a little more "rationale" meat in this book, but it's entirely geared toward getting someone going on a program. So if you're looking for a set of programs that you can follow to do "strength training for fat loss" this book is for you. If you're looking for "deep thoughts on strength training for fat loss," it is not. Great book, just not what I was looking for.

Die 3 Cs sind der Kern dieses Buchs: Circuits, Combinations und Complexes. Kombinationen von Übungen, die man in verschiedenen Reihenfolgen hintereinander abarbeitet, könnte man auch sagen. Die meisten Übungen sind grundlegende Übungen, ein paar sind forgtgeschrittene Kombinationen wie der Turkish Getup, aber letztendlich nichts neues. Das Buch ist mit gutem Schulenglisch und ein paar kratftrainingsspezifischen Fremdsprachenkenntnissen flüssig zu lesen. Typische amerikanische Literatur mit ihren mehrfachen Wiederholungen derselben Aussagen sollte man allerdings schon gewohnt sein, den dieses Buch treibt es auf die Spitze: Die Übungen werden erklärt, und dann in jeder Trainingsabfolge nochmal. Kommen sie dort mehrfach vor, dann mehrmals. Beispielsweise gibt es einen Complex, in dem mehrere Übungen immer abwechselnd mit einem Farmer' s Walk ausgeführt werden. Übung 1, Farmer's Walk mit Erklärung und Bildern. Übung 2 mit Erklärung. Übung 3, Farmer' s Walk, erneut mit textgleicher Erklärung der Übung. Nur die Bilder hat man weggelassen. Übung 4 mit Erklärung, Übung 5 - Sie ahnen es schon: : Farmer's Walk, erneut mit Erklärung. Und so weiter. Auf diese Weise bekommt man auch beispielsweise den Barbell Squat (Kniebeuge mit Langhantel) bestimmt 8 bis 10 Mal im Buchz erklärt; jedes Mal textgleich, mit Bildern. Würde man die Kapitel des Buchs zusammenfassen und für die Übungen auf eine Erläuterung im Anhang verweisen, dann hätte man zwei Drittel Papier gespart und den Leser nicht bis aufs äußerste gelangweilt. Will man sinnvollen Inhalt ergänzen, wären typische Fehlerquellen und mehr Ansichten bei den Übungen viel hilfreicher gewesen als immer wiederkehrende Textbausteine, weil es sich bei den meisten Übungen doch um sehr komplexe Übungen handelt, die sich der Anfänger erst erarbeiten muß - am besten unter Aufsicht. Fazit: Wie soll man einen mit Wasser aufs doppelte verdünnten Eintopf bewerten, der an sich ganz gute Zutaten hätte? Nicht schlecht; nicht mehr, nicht weniger. Wäre das Buch entweder kürzer oder ausführlicher, hätte es mindestens 4 Sterne verdient.
